Transaction 95b5dbf2c36a2ee7a3432a07acd62f6f8d7e6f85d2ff5627ce9cc6527ce3411e

1 Input
2 Outputs
  • 95b5dbf2c36a2ee7a3432a07acd62f6f8d7e6f85d2ff5627ce9cc6527ce3411e:0
  • value  13597000000
    address  3FvGTVYGfocZeBBwpgr32RKURKWWvCTKLi
  • 95b5dbf2c36a2ee7a3432a07acd62f6f8d7e6f85d2ff5627ce9cc6527ce3411e:1
  • value  23743739600
    address  3JEAszztBTBtsGgxT75mX1QMmvp3FbtLZy